Output eac1decb81e3c6b89517ffafc2930034fc244f5b9e4868c3fa7d4b547555bdf7:1

value
7094563
script pubkey
OP_0 OP_PUSHBYTES_20 38f960db450ea14366815d01de5d155efb72ebbd
address
bc1q8rukpk69p6s5xe5pt5qauhg4tmah96aapzcqgl
transaction
eac1decb81e3c6b89517ffafc2930034fc244f5b9e4868c3fa7d4b547555bdf7
confirmations
147590
spent
true